Rasmus Stjerne (Hvidovre, DEN) finished 6-3 in the 0-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, Stjerne defeated Thomas Dufour (Chamonix, FRA) 11-3, then won 7-3 against Ritvars Gulbis (Riga, LAT). Stjerne went on to lose 8-3 against Niklas Edin (Karlstad, SWE). Stjerne responded with a 6-5 win over Jiri Snitil (Prague, CZE). Stjerne won 7-4 against Joel Retornaz (Cortina, ITA), then won 5-2 against David Murdoch (Lockerbie, SCO) and 8-6 against Germany's Christopher Bartsch. Stjerne went on to lose 7-6 against Sven Michel (Adelboden, SUI). Stjerne lost 6-4 to Thomas Ulsrud (Oslo, NOR) in their final qualifying round match.
Stjerne earned 30.000 world rankings points for their Top 3 finish in the Le Gruyere European Curling Championships, moving up 16 spots the World Ranking Standings into 30th place overall with 74.942 total points. Stjerne ranks 17th overall on the Year-to-Date rankings with 52.442 points earned so far this season.
